P.V.KUNHIKRISHNAN, J.

-------------------------------- Crl.M.C. Nos. 7102 & 7091 of 2023 ---------------------------------------------- Dated this the 11th day of September, 2023

ORDER

These Criminal Miscellaneous Cases are filed under Section 482 of the Code of Criminal Procedure, 1973 (“the Code” for the sake of brevity).

2. The petitioners in these cases are same and

they are accused nos.1 and 5 in C.C. No.154/2012 and C.C. No.120/2012 on the files of Chief Judicial Magistrate Court, Pathanamthitta. The Crl.M.C. No.7102/2023 is filed with a prayer to quash Annexure 4 and 5 orders in Crl.M.P. Nos.212 & 213 of 2023 dated 12.01.2023 in C.C. No.154/2012 on the files of Chief Judicial Magistrate Court, Pathanamthitta. The Crl.M.C. No.7091/2023 is filed to quash Annexure-A4 and A5 orders in Crl. M.P. Nos.609 and 608 of 2023 dated 02.02.2023 in C.C. No.120/2012 on the files of Chief Judicial Magistrate Court, Pathanamthitta.

3. The petitioners are accused and they filed

application under Section 205 of Cr.P.C. seeking exemption from personal appearance. It is stated that the 1st petitioner is a cancer patient and undergoing treatment and the 2nd petitioner is the wife of the 1st petitioner and she is looking after the 1st petitioner. It is submitted that the learned Magistrate dismissed the exemption application in Crl. M.C. No.7091/2023 for the reason that a warrant is pending against the petitioner in the connected case. The same is challenged in Crl. M.C. No.7102/2023 in which also an application for exemption is submitted and the same is rejected. Hence, this Crl. M.C. is filed.

4. Heard the learned counsel for the petitioners and the learned Public Prosecutor.

5. The petitioners approached this Court

earlier by filing Crl.M.C. No.6973/2023 and 1652/2023 etc. in which also the petitioners prays for permenent exemption in appearing in the cases pending before the Chief Judicial Magistrate Court, Pathanamthitta. It will be better to extract the relevant portion of the

order dated 25.08.2023 in Crl. M.C. No.6973/2023:

“6. I find that a learned single judge of this Court has considered identical issues while disposing of Crl.M.C.No.1874 of 2023 and connected cases. This Court, after taking note of the law laid down in Bhanujan v. Jayabhanu [1993 (2) KLT 889], M/s. Bhaskar Industries Ltd. v. Bhiwani Denim and Apparels Ltd. and Others [AIR 2001 SC 3625], Sarath v. State of Kerala [2017 (3) KLT 95] and Moosa Pattupura v. State of Kerala [2022 (2) KHC 293] had

occasion to hold that that Section 317(1) Cr.P.C. empowers the Judge or Magistrate to dispense with the personal attendance of the accused and proceed with the trial in his absence. This Court further observed that ordinarily, the Court should be generous and liberal under Section 205 and Section 317 of Cr.P.C. and grant exemption to the accused from personal appearance unless the presence is imperatively needed or becomes indispensable. The same view was taken by this Court in Crl.M.C. No.2951 of 2023 as well. In that view of the matter, following the directions issued by this Court in Crl.M.C.Nos.1684 of 2023 and Crl.M.C. No.2951 of 2023, these petitions are allowed by ordering as under. a) The order dated 12.1.2023 in Crl.M.P. No.439/2023 in C.C.No.110/2012 and order dated 02.02.2023 in Crl.M.P. No.616/2023 in C.C.No.130/2012 on the files of the Chief Judicial Magistrate Court, Pathanamthitta are set aside. b) The petitioners are granted permanent exemption from appearance under Section 205(1) of the Cr.P.C and shall be represented by their Counsel at the time of trial. c) The petitioners shall file affidavits in tune with the directions in M/s.Bhaskar Industries Limited

(supra). d) Petitioners shall appear before the Court at the time of questioning under Section 313 Cr.P.C as well as on the date of judgment, and the exemption granted as above shall not be applicable in view of the undertaken given by the petitioner. It is made clear that Subsection 205(2) shall always apply, and if the presence of the petitioners is otherwise required, it would be open to the Magistrate to insist on their appearance, however, subject to the orders above. e) It is reiterated that the exemption granted as above shall be subject to a further direction that the petitioners shall appear if they are so otherwise directed by the court tying the matter.”

Following the above directions issued by this Court, these Criminal Miscellaneous Cases are disposed of with the following directions; a. The impugned order in Crl.M.C. No.7091/2023 and Crl.M.C. No.7102/2023 are quashed. b) The petitioners are granted permanent exemption from appearance under Section 205(1) of the Cr.P.C and shall be represented by their Counsel at the time of trial. c) The petitioners shall file affidavits in tune with the directions in M/s.Bhaskar Industries Limited (supra). d) Petitioners shall appear before the Court at the time of questioning under Section 313 Cr.P.C as well as on the date of judgment, and the exemption granted as above shall not be applicable in view of the undertaken given by the petitioner. It is made clear that Subsection 205(2) shall always apply, and if the presence of the petitioners is otherwise required, it would be open to the Magistrate to insist on their appearance, however, subject to the orders above. e) It is reiterated that the exemption granted as above shall be subject to a further direction that the petitioners shall appear if they are so otherwise directed by the court trying the matter.
